Proud Coventry boss Mark Robins believes his side passed a massive test by beating their promotion rivals Portsmouth 1-0.

Substitute Matt Godden broke the stalemate after he slotted home with six minutes to go with a close-range finish.

“We had to dig deep, it wasn’t a brilliant spectacle but it was a massive three points for us,” said Robins.

“I am just pleased we have stopped their winning run, it gives us confidence going into the game on Saturday (at Southend) after beating a team in really good form.

“This was a big test and a challenge that we have passed.

“The players have dealt with a really big threat and deserve a lot of praise, we will take those three points, they are huge for us.

“We will have to keep defending like that for the rest of the season.

“We were able to keep them at bay, both wing-backs as well as did the centre-halves. We defended better than we have done before, but we had to.

“There was some decent football played and we moved the ball better generally and tried to get on the front foot.”

Portsmouth boss Kenny Jackett, whose side had won their last nine games in all competitions, was left to rue a lack of cutting edge.

“We were on top, and particularly in the second half, looked like were were going to get a goal,” he said.

“There were chances but Coventry defended their box well, when we were on top in the second half and looked strong you need to score and we got a sucker punch towards the end.

“We had defended very well but just got caught.

“It shows you that you need to get goals when you are on top and going forward. It is a frustration not to get anything out of the game.

“In the first half we couldn’t quite find the shots, but as the second half wore on we were on top.

“We had enough of the game and enough of the ball to get something.

“We don’t want to make it two defeats and we have to bounce back.

“There are 15 games left, so a third of the season, we are sixth and have a good side.”
